More about Las Vegas Rescue Mission

The LVRM provides hope and change for the homeless and hungry population in southern Nevada. They strive to be the model for other organizations. The proceeds from this event fund their programs and services that assist the homeless for a better tomorrow. This organization receives no government support, except for a small grant specifically for food, and relies upon the compassion and support of organizations, corporations, churches and individuals.

Founded in 1970, the Las Vegas Rescue Mission started with a small storefront building. The services included a chapel, kitchen and a shelter for housing a few men. Nowadays the mission’s campus covers two city blocks to help hundreds and providing 30,000 meals monthly. You can also give back by shopping at the thrift shop on the campus.

Savory Story Behind National Doughnut Day

As you may know, the first Friday of June has a connection to one particularly savory sweet confection – the donut. But, do you know the story behind National Donut Day? The first donut day event took place in 1938 in Chicago as a fundraiser created by The Salvation Army to assist the disadvantage during The Great Depression.

Present Day Chicago continues to keep the tradition of giving back alive. Through The Salvation Army’s Mobile Feeding and Outreach Program, funds raised on National Donut support Chicagoland area:

  • Food pantries;
  • Nutrition programs for children; in addition to,
  • Meals for senior citizens and homeless.

Other Fun Facts About National Donut Day

  • National Donut Day pays tribute to The Salvation Army “Donut Lassies” who supported front line troops during World War I.
  • The nickname “Donut Lassies” originated from two volunteers that used limited supplies, resources, and soldier helmets to fry much-appreciated donuts for the troops. (Seven at a time.)
  • “Donut Lassies” didn’t just make donuts for soldiers. They also provided stamps, writing supplies, meals, and mending services.
  • National Donut Day helps raise funds and increase awareness about the many social service programs The Salvation Army offers.

More About National Police Week & Police Wives of America

Congress established National Police Week in 1962. During the week many organizations collaborate together to recognizing the service and sacrifices of U.S. Law Enforcement. National Police Week pays special recognition to those law enforcement officers. Most noteworthy, those who lost their lives in the line of duty for the safety and protection of others.

Police Wives of America is a national nonprofit that unites police wives across America. The organization focuses on becoming one team with one purpose. To support law enforcement men and women and their families during difficult and joyful life milestones. The Las Vegas Metro Police Wives chapter opened in May of 2009. Since its inception, the Las Vegas chapter membership has grown to over 650 wives.
